Mayo Clinic Platform_Accelerate Launches New AI Health Tech Cohort

The program offers participants access to Mayo Clinic’s expert mentor network, cutting-edge technologies, and millions of de-identified, longitudinal clinical records.

Mayo Clinic Platform_Accelerate has unveiled its newest cohort of 11 health tech startups set to participate in a comprehensive 30-week program focused on developing and validating AI-driven healthcare solutions.

Participants will gain access to Mayo Clinic’s network of expert mentors, cutting-edge technologies, and millions of de-identified, longitudinal clinical records.

The selected startups, representing both national and international companies, will also have opportunities to connect with leading investors and healthcare executives to help grow their businesses.

“The only way to transform healthcare is by uniting clinical experts with technology innovators,” said John Halamka, M.D., Diercks president of Mayo Clinic Platform. “Our Accelerate program links startups with Mayo Clinic physicians and scientists to turn innovative ideas into practical healthcare solutions.”

The latest cohort features:

  • Bowhead Health – developing a radiogenomics platform that uses imaging to predict genomic mutations and guide personalized treatment and clinical trial matching.
  • Cleancard – creating an AI-powered, at-home cancer detection test that delivers lab-grade diagnostics in 30 minutes.
  • Dart Health – implementing hospital-wide AI solutions by embedding engineering teams on-site to tackle clinical and operational challenges.
  • Kanjo Health – utilizing AI and evidence-based insights to provide early, personalized care for children with ADHD and autism.
  • Koroid – forecasting clinical demand and automating healthcare logistics to ensure efficient, safe, and quality-driven care.
  • MedLink Global – advancing AI-driven precision psychiatry with tools for accurate diagnoses and personalized treatment.
  • MyAtlas Health – leveraging AI and wearable data to predict mental health crises early and deliver preventive support.
  • Ordinatrum Health – improving critical care through AI-powered, FDA-cleared virtual ICUs and integrated data systems.
  • Promed AI – combining at-home testing with multimodal AI to provide affordable, personalized preventive healthcare.
  • RTHM – enhancing diagnosis and treatment of complex chronic illnesses such as long COVID and chronic fatigue syndrome.
  • Radical – creating a general-purpose AI model for oncology that generates personalized treatment recommendations to improve outcomes and reduce costs.

“We’re excited to welcome our October cohort of 11 companies who are advancing the frontiers of AI in healthcare,” said Jamie Sundsbak, director of the Accelerate program. “Their passion and vision embody the core of Accelerate: bold innovation, strong collaboration, and an unwavering commitment to improving patient outcomes. We’re proud to support their journey and eager to see the breakthroughs they’ll achieve.”
